About CARSTAR

CARSTAR is a champion of the independent collision repair operators, consequently, CARSTAR is the largest automotive collision repair franchise in North America. The well publicized industry dynamitics: declining repair opportunities, acceleration in shops being de-selected from Insurance referral programs, excess repair capacity, increased competition from Multi-Shop Operators and Consolidators, and scarcity of skilled labor, has changed how the Independent Collision Repair Operator needs to conduct business. The CARSTAR Franchise program offers many solutions to these and other issues in which you and your business may be facing. We believe we are the champion for quality Independent shops, providing effective training solutions, staying involved in National and Local Industry Associations and developing sale and marketing programs to help our Franchisees compete in this turbulent market.

CARSTAR leverages the purchasing power of Driven Brands to provide tremendous benefits for our CARSTAR store owners. Nearly 50 corporately managed purchasing programs provide our CARSTAR partners on average $25,000 or more in cost savings and rebates. With larger volume stores easily surpassing that amount in rebates. Store owners also benefit from a national fleet program, top vendor partnerships and support from national service providers.

The total investment necessary to begin operation of a conversion CARSTAR franchise is $23,500 to $165,300. This includes $10,000 to $20,000 that must be paid to the franchisor or affiliate. The total investment necessary to begin operation of a new (ground-up) CARSTAR franchise is $298,200 to $804,300. This includes $10,000 to $20,000 that must be paid to the franchisor or affiliate.

About Brake King

Sam Hutchison opened Brake King in 1966 on Jefferson Avenue in Newport News, VA. Under Sam's leadership, Brake King quickly grew from 10 to 18 service bays, becoming the largest automotive repair facility in Hampton Roads. Following Sam's passing in 1977, his son Randy took over the business that he had been working in for most of his life. Even though by this time Brake King had become a staple in the Newport News community, Randy set out to mold it into something larger. He added yet 2 more service bays to the already impressive facility and set out on a mission to offer the quickest possible service for the absolute lowest prices. With this business plan in place, over the next 2 decades Brake King became an institution in Southeast Virginia. It is not only known for its quick service and low prices, but for its knowledgeable and friendly technicians who assist the customer throughout the entire repair process. It's this close relationship between the customer and the person that is actually working on their vehicle that truly sets Brake King apart. All of this, along with Brake King's 3 key principles of honesty, integrity, and over the top customer service has allowed Brake King to become the preeminent family owned automotive repair facility in the state of Virginia. Since 1966, Brake King has serviced over 500,000 vehicles from its one location and now currently has 30,000 customers in its growing database. Brake King customers travel from as far south as North Carolina and as far north as Washington DC to experience the difference.
